I like him in this role coming off the bench. Still clumsy with the ball, but his pressing was great and got the goal.

With the lack of creativity in midfield and David being limited we need a guy who can come in and get us a goal in deadball situations etc.
We definitely need an alternative to David, and based on this two first games it seems that Vlahovic coming on as an impact sub actually works because he is very different to David in terms of being an aerial threat and off the ball movement that probably even defenders take a while to adjust.
